Ange Percy

Ange Percy is a multi-disciplinary artist whose practice spans ceramics, installation, textiles, painting and printmaking. Her current work explores the way objects carry traces of personal history and are assigned meaning through use, gesture and interaction.

Percy frequently uses material processes as a means of reflection, allowing the physical qualities of making to mirror emotional and conceptual development. Repetition, labour and the accumulation of marks are recurring elements within her work, functioning both as technical processes and as metaphors for persistence, devotion and growth.

This installation brings together a series of handmade stoneware mugs arranged around the gallery space alongside domestic furniture elements. Gathered in loose familial groupings, the mugs evoke traces of the absent interactions they helped to facilitate. The work considers the significance of domestic and utility objects, exploring how these items become intertwined with memory, relationships and ordinary rhythms of life.
